    I got selected to the second round of interviews and testing for the City Carrier Assistant…read moreposition. One of the first things they mention in the orientation is that the job position is part time, on call, and with zero guarantee of hours. No where in the job posting on Indeed.com was this mentioned (which Indeed definitely lets you designate). They wait until you schedule time off and you show up in person to let you know this fact. They said if you have a problem with this you should exit the interview now. We'll thanks for the heads up and loss of a day's wage to apply for a job that I would have skipped if I had known all the facts. Honestly I wish I could sue them if lawyers weren't so expensive. Another applicant followed after me and opted out of the application process too. The instructions for the orientation mention "do not bring children" to the interview. So that implies people might be having to get daycare to apply to this bogus job opening. This is beyond inconsiderate for people who have children and are already on limited budgets. Although this is not me, I sympathize with single parents applying for these jobs. Let's face it, if they told the truth nobody would apply to this job. This should have been described as "seasonal work with no guarantee of hours". If I lied or withheld facts on my job application, I would be disqualified (and rightfully so). Yet the same courtesy is not granted in return. USPS used to be a great organization. My grandfather worked for them and things were better back in his time. Nowadays, I can't tell the difference between them and Amazon on how they operate. Shame on you USPS.
